Mount Rinjani, the second-highest volcano in Indonesia, stands tall at 3,726 meters on the island of Lombok. Its dramatic crater lake, sweeping ridgelines, and spiritual atmosphere make it one of Southeast Asia's most sought-after trekking destinations. What Is Included in a Rinjani Trekking Package?
Before comparing packages, it helps to understand what most operators offer as standard. The key differences between packages usually come down to duration, comfort level, group size, and the specific summit or route targeted. Knowing what you need — and what you can live without — makes choosing the right package much easier.

Mid-Range Packages: The Sweet Spot for Most Trekkers
The mid-range Rinjani trekking package is the most popular choice, and for good reason — it balances cost with comfort in a way that suits the majority of visitors. These three-day, two-night packages typically include a crater rim overnight stay, a descent to the sacred Segara Anak Lake, and a visit to the hot springs at its shore. Equipment quality is noticeably better, group sizes are smaller, and guides tend to offer more personal attention throughout the climb. Summit Packages: For the Peak Baggers
If standing on the true summit of Rinjani at 3,726 meters is your goal, a summit package is the one to book. These are typically four-day, three-night adventures that include the full crater rim, a night at high camp, the pre-dawn summit push, a day at the lake, and a full descent. They demand good physical fitness and some prior trekking experience. The reward — a sunrise view from one of Indonesia's highest peaks with the crater lake glowing below — is worth every step of the journey.

Tips for Choosing the Right Package
Picking the right Rinjani trekking package comes down to three things: your budget, your fitness level, and what you want to experience on the mountain. Always verify that your operator holds the proper permits and employs certified local guides — this protects both the environment and your safety. Read recent traveler reviews, ask about equipment quality before booking, and confirm what is and isn't included in the price. Hidden costs for park entry fees or porter tips can add up if not clarified upfront. A transparent, reputable operator will be happy to walk you through every detail.
